^^^this. These things work great. I think our can be set out to about 150yd diameter. Enough to keep Morty on the main yard. But they’ll get smart and stand at the perimeter until the warning stops, then it’s free to roam as the batteries in the collar are dead. Don’t forget to remove the collar when you bring puppy in the truck for a ride!…lol
